Study the effect of alumina and magnesia additions on the sequestration loss property of bentonite

Abstract
Iraqi bentonite was mainly used for ceramic models with additions of alumina and magnesia. Ceramic models were prepared with weight ratios (5% to 25%) of alumina and magnesia and were thermally treated at a temperature of 1300 degrees Celsius. Some models with addition ratios of less than 15% for each of alumina and magnesia did not withstand. As for the models that stabilized, the addition ratios were 20% and 25%. The isolation loss property was studied, and the results of the isolation loss showed a significant decrease when the frequency was increased.
